[PATCHv3, RFC 09/34] thp: represent file thp pages in meminfo and friends

From: Kirill A. Shutemov
Date: Fri Apr 05 2013 - 08:05:28 EST


From: "Kirill A. Shutemov" <kirill.shutemov@xxxxxxxxxxxxxxx>

The patch adds new zone stat to count file transparent huge pages and
adjust related places.

For now we don't count mapped or dirty file thp pages separately.
